Whether you're embarking on a journey to explore the charming landscapes of South West England or simply commuting for work, Tiverton Parkway train station offers convenience and efficiency. Nestled near the M5 motorway, it serves as a key hub for both locals and tourists, providing easy access to an array of destinations across the UK. Known for its tranquil setting and accessible facilities, this station ensures a smooth travel experience, capable of meeting the needs of all passengers, including those requiring special assistance.
The station hosts a wealth of amenities to make your journey as pleasant as possible. Tiverton Parkway boasts a ticket office open throughout the week, with operational hours starting as early as 6:05 AM on weekdays. Alongside traditional ticketing, there are ticket machines for easy purchase and collection of tickets bought online. For those who rely on technology to assist their hearing, induction loops are available.
Accessibility is also a priority at the station, with some step-free access and ramps provided for boarding trains. There are 453 car parking spaces managed by APCOA Parking, including several accessible spots to ensure that everyone can make use of the facilities with ease. Moreover, for cyclists, there are 70 bike spaces available, complete with a repair station to ensure your bicycle is travel-ready.
Ready to venture beyond Tiverton Parkway? The station is well linked with public transport services that will whisk you away to your next adventure. Taxis are readily available at the station entrance, and for those inclined towards public transport, a comprehensive bus timetable is accessible to plan your journey. Traveling further? You can easily transfer at Reading for Heathrow and Gatwick Airport services or head to Bristol Temple Meads for a connection to Bristol Airport.
